AFX News Limited: Shell says nine of the 25 missing contractors in Nigeria released

10.03.2006 
 
LONDON (AFX) – Nine of the 25 contractors of Royal Dutch Shell PLC who were abducted during an attack by armed separatist militants on Monday have been released, a Shell spokeswoman said.

‘We’ve learned that nine of the 25 contractors have just been released,’ she said.

The contractors were working on a supply boat yesterday when they were attacked by a number of armed men on high-speed motorboats.

Several Nigerian soldiers were killed in the confrontations, according to Nigerian press reports.

Responsibility for the attack was claimed by the Joint Revolutionary Council, a structure which groups together several separatist movements.

The JRC said in a statement published by several dailies that the attack was aimed at obtaining the immediate release of Alhaji Mujahid Dokubo Asar, the imprisoned leader of the Niger Delta People’s Volunteer Force.
